– **數據庫端口**:一般為3306(MySQL)、5432(PostgreSQL)等。
– **數據庫名稱**:之前創(chuàng)建的數據庫名稱。
– **用戶名**:為數據庫創(chuàng)建的用戶。
– **密碼**:對應用戶的密碼。
### 3.3 示例代碼
以下以PHP為例展示如何連接虛擬主機與云服務器的MySQL數據庫:
“`php
<?php
$servername = \”云服務器IP地址\”;
$username = \”數據庫用戶名\”;
$password = \”數據庫密碼\”;
$dbname = \”數據庫名稱\”;
// 創(chuàng)建連接
$conn = new mysqli($servername, $username, $password, $dbname);
// 檢測連接
if ($conn->connect_error) {
die(\”連接失敗: \” . $conn->connect_error);
}
echo \”連接成功\”;
// 關閉連接
$conn->close();
?>
“`
## 第四部分:常見問題及解決方案
### 4.1 連接失敗
如果出現連接失敗的情況,可能是以下原因:
1. **IP地址未被允許**:檢查云服務器的數據庫配置,確保虛擬主機的IP地址已被白名單允許。
2. **防火墻設置**:檢查云服務器的防火墻設置,確保對應端口已開放。
3. **數據庫服務未啟動**:確認云服務器上的數據庫服務正在運行。
### 4.2 性能問題
如果在連接過程中出現性能問題,可以考慮以下建議:
1. **優(yōu)化數據庫查詢**:通過索引、緩存等技術優(yōu)化數據庫查詢性能。
2. **使用連接池**:在代碼中使用連接池技術減少連接建立的時間。
3. **監(jiān)控數據庫性能**:使用監(jiān)控工具監(jiān)測數據庫性能,及時發(fā)現潛在瓶頸。
### 4.3 安全問題
在連接云服務器數據庫時,務必要關注安全性:
1. **使用SSL連接**:啟用SSL加密連接,保護數據傳輸的安全性。
2. **定期更新密碼**:定期更換數據庫用戶密碼,增強安全性。
3. **限制用戶權限**:按照最小權限原則,限制數據庫用戶的訪問權限。
## 結論
虛擬主機連接云服務器數據庫是現代在線應用架構中的重要環(huán)節(jié)。在實現過程中,用戶需謹慎配置網絡環(huán)境、數據庫參數以及安全設置,以確保連接的成功和數據的安全。通過了解基礎概念、準備工作和實際連接步驟,用戶可以更好地利用虛擬主機和云服務器的優(yōu)勢,為自己的業(yè)務發(fā)展打下堅實的基礎。
以上就是小編關于“虛擬主機連接云服務器數據庫”的分享和介紹
西部數碼(west.cn)是經工信部、ICANN、CNNIC認證的全球頂級域名注冊服務機構,是中國五星級域名注冊商!有超過2000萬個域名通過西部數碼注冊并管理,超過100萬個網站托管在西部數碼云服務器和虛擬主機。西部數碼支持數十個頂級域名的注冊與管理,支持批量查詢、批量注冊、批量解析、智能解析、批量過戶等便捷好用的功能,擁有非常好的使用體驗。
目前,西部數碼域名注冊正在特價,最低僅需1元!
更多詳情請見:http://ps-sw.cn/services/domain/
西部數碼域名搶注預定,支持搶注各類高價值老域名,支持“建站歷史、百度收錄、百度權重、歷史外鏈、百度評價、搜狗反鏈”等數十項綜合檢索功能?。】煽焖倬珳识ㄎ坏侥胍ㄎ坏降母黝惥酚蛎?!同時,西部數碼域名搶注集成了全球多個搶注商(近200個搶注商,還將陸續(xù)增加),整理出10多條搶注通道,從根本上提升了搶注成功率!
其中,1號通道,實測搶注成功率高達99% 。每天西部數碼預釋放功能還會釋放若干優(yōu)質過期域名,可以直接搶注競拍。
趕緊預訂搶注心儀的優(yōu)質域名吧:http://ps-sw.cn/booking/